Cyclin-dependent kinase inhibitor p21Waf1: Contemporary view on its role in senescence and oncogenesis

Abstract: p21(Waf1) was identified as a protein suppressing cyclin E/A-CDK2 activity and was originally considered as a negative regulator of the cell cycle and a tumor suppressor. It is now considered that p21(Waf1) has alternative functions, and the view of its role in cellular processes has begun to change. At present, p21(Waf1) is known to be involved in regulation of fundamental cellular programs: cell proliferation, differentiation, migration, senescence, and apoptosis. “…p21/WAF1 is also known as cyclindependent kinase (CDK) inhibitor 1 or CDK-interacting protein 1. p21/WAF1 is a cell cycle checkpoint, where cells either set about repairing themselves or commit suicide through apoptosis (52,53). The p21/WAF1 protein functions as a regulator of cell cycle progression at the G1 phase by inhibiting cyclin-CDK2 or -CDK1 activity (52,54,55).…”
